All of the automatic queue features are available for externally and internally multi-
plexed channels. The software selects externally multiplexed mode by setting the
MUX bit in QACR0.
Figure 5-3
to the QADC64. The external multiplexers select one of eight analog inputs and con-
nect it to one analog output, which becomes an input to the QADC64. The QADC64
provides three multiplexed address signals (MA[2:0]), to select one of eight inputs.
These outputs are connected to all four multiplexers. The analog output of each mul-
tiplexer is each connected to one of four separate QADC64 inputs — ANw, ANx, ANy,
and ANz.
